Diamond Characteristics

If there is one thing that characterizes a diamond, it is four key points, the 4C's: weight (carat), color, clarity (purity), and cut (cut). The price of diamonds varies according to their weight, color, and purity, which makes them the most valuable gemstone on the market.

 

Methods for recognizing a real diamond from a fake diamond

  • Water test

The water test is the simplest and most common way to distinguish a real diamond from a fake. You simply have to fill a glass with water up to 3/4 of its capacity. Then introduce the stone into the glass slowly.

If the diamond sinks we have good news, it is real. On the contrary, if it floats or stays in the middle of the glass, it probably means that you have a fake diamond. This is mainly because real stones have a high density, so this test is usually quite reliable to determine if it is a real stone or a fake.

 

  • Reading through the diamond

Another test that works best to determine if it is a real or fake diamond is to read through it. To do this we will place the stone on a piece of paper that is written on it and check if we can read it. If we are not able to see the text you will know that it is a fake. On the contrary, if you can read through the stone it means that it is a real diamond.

 

  • The brilliance test

Another easy and simple test to distinguish a real diamond from a fake is its brilliance. To do this you will have to place the diamond under a lamp. Once you have placed the stone, you should carefully observe how the light reflects on the stone.

If you see an extraordinary sparkle reflected on the jewel, it is probably a real diamond. The sparkles provided by diamonds are of a grayish tone, which will guarantee you that it is a real jewel.

  • The vapor test

Another simple tip to find out if it is a real jewel or a fake is the vapor test. To do this, you simply exhale on the diamond. If no mist appears, the diamond is real.

On the other hand, if you notice that a vapor stain appears, it is probably a fake. This is because diamond is one of the strongest and most resistant raw materials on earth. Therefore, before an exhalation, the diamond remains crystalline and transparent.

 

  • Ask a professional jeweler for advice

If after these tests you still do not feel confident enough that your jewel is real or fake you can ask us or any jeweler in your area, for that, you will have to bring the stone so that he can check with professional means what kind of stone it is and can even certify it or manage an international certificate.

There are several professional tests such as the microscope test, the weight test with a precision scale, or the test with a UV lamp that ensure the authenticity of diamonds.

 

  • Certificate

When you buy diamond jewelry, the way that guarantees you 100% how to know if a diamond ring is real is through a Certificate from a Certification Laboratory that brings validity to the diamond. Some of the most common diamond certifying laboratories are the GIA, AGS, IGI, EGL, GSI, HRD, BGI, and IGE.

 

How to differentiate a diamond from a zirconia

Diamond is the hardest natural stone in nature, and thanks to its properties, it is also one of the most valuable. Zirconia, popularly known as zirconite, is a synthetic stone of artificial origin and its visual similarity to diamond is incredible.

They are so similar that it can be difficult to differentiate a diamond ring from a zirconia ring. To make this task easier, we recommend that you use one of these tricks:

  • Scale test: zirconia will weigh twice as much as a diamond of the same size.
  • White paper test: draw a dot with a pencil or black pen on white paper. Place the diamond centered on the dot and see if it is distinguishable or not. In the first case, it will be zirconia, while in the second case, it will be a genuine diamond.
  • Lens test: the edges of zirconia are rounded and those of diamonds are pointed. In addition, with a magnifying glass, you will be able to observe if it has scratches on its surface because the diamond is so hard that it does not usually present anomalies, unlike the zirconia.
  • Go to a professional jeweler: if you are unable to distinguish and recognize a diamond from zirconia despite using these tricks, a professional jeweler will certify and check whether it is a genuine piece or a zirconia. You can already test your diamond jewelry!

 

How to differentiate a diamond from a lab-created diamond

Laboratory diamonds, synthetic diamonds, or artificial diamonds, are created by humans. Consequently, they are cheaper and more ethical, as mining has a strong impact on the environment. Laboratory diamonds are created by various means of production and seek to offer the same beauty as real natural diamonds.

To differentiate a real diamond from a lab-created diamond is to look at the grading report. If an expert wants to determine whether a diamond is natural or lab-grown, he uses a magnifying glass to observe its imperfections. The imperfections of a natural diamond are different from those of a lab-grown diamond. Sometimes there are also slight differences in the way the diamond reflects light.
